Gather the Right Supplies
Before you start packing fragile items, ensure you have the right supplies on hand. Essential packing materials include sturdy cardboard boxes in various sizes, bubble wrap, packing peanuts, packing paper, packing tape, and markers for labeling. Having the appropriate supplies ensures that your delicate items are properly protected throughout the moving or shipping process.
Wrap Each Item Individually
When packing fragile items, it’s crucial to wrap each item individually to provide adequate cushioning and protection. Start by wrapping the item with several layers of bubble wrap, paying special attention to the corners and delicate parts. Secure the bubble wrap in place with packing tape. For additional protection, consider placing the wrapped item in a layer of packing paper or foam before placing it in the box.
Use Proper Padding and Fillers
To prevent items from shifting and colliding during transportation, use proper padding and fillers inside the box. Place a layer of packing peanuts or crumpled packing paper at the bottom of the box for cushioning. Nestle each wrapped item in the box, ensuring there is enough padding between them. Fill any remaining gaps with packing peanuts or additional layers of bubble wrap to provide stability and minimize movement.
Label Boxes as Fragile
Clearly label the boxes containing fragile items as “Fragile” or “Handle with Care.” This will alert the hauling service or anyone handling the boxes to exercise caution. Use a permanent marker to write the labels on multiple sides of the box to ensure they are easily visible. Proper labeling helps ensure that your delicate belongings receive the necessary attention and care during the transportation process.
